								# --description--
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								In this exercise we are going to create a class named `Set` to emulate an abstract data structure called "set". A set is like an array, but it cannot contain duplicate values. The typical use for a set is to simply check for the presence of an item. We can see how the ES6 `Set` object works in the example below:
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								```js
							 | 
						||
| 
								 | 
							
								const set1 = new Set([1, 2, 3, 5, 5, 2, 0]);
							 | 
						||
| 
								 | 
							
								console.log(set1);
							 | 
						||
| 
								 | 
							
								// output: {1, 2, 3, 5, 0}
							 | 
						||
| 
								 | 
							
								console.log(set1.has(1));
							 | 
						||
| 
								 | 
							
								// output: true
							 | 
						||
| 
								 | 
							
								console.log(set1.has(6));
							 | 
						||
| 
								 | 
							
								// output: false
							 | 
						||
| 
								 | 
							
								```
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								First, we will create an add method that adds a value to our set collection as long as the value does not already exist in the set. Then we will create a remove method that removes a value from the set collection if it already exists. And finally, we will create a size method that returns the number of elements inside the set collection.
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								# --instructions--
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								Create an `add` method that adds a unique value to the set collection and returns `true` if the value was successfully added and `false` otherwise.
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								Create a `remove` method that accepts a value and checks if it exists in the set. If it does, then this method should remove it from the set collection, and return `true`. Otherwise, it should return `false`. Create a `size` method that returns the size of the set collection.

								# --solutions--
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								```js
							 | 
						||
| 
								 | 
							
								class Set {
							 | 
						||
| 
								 | 
							
								  constructor() {
							 | 
						||
| 
								 | 
							
								    this.dictionary = {};
							 | 
						||
| 
								 | 
							
								    this.length = 0;
							 | 
						||
| 
								 | 
							
								  }
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								  has(element) {
							 | 
						||
| 
								 | 
							
								    return this.dictionary[element] !== undefined;
							 | 
						||
| 
								 | 
							
								  }
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								  values() {
							 | 
						||
| 
								 | 
							
								    return Object.values(this.dictionary);
							 | 
						||
| 
								 | 
							
								  }
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								  add(element) {
							 | 
						||
| 
								 | 
							
								    if (!this.has(element)) {
							 | 
						||
| 
								 | 
							
								      this.dictionary[element] = element;
							 | 
						||
| 
								 | 
							
								      this.length++;
							 | 
						||
| 
								 | 
							
								      return true;
							 | 
						||
| 
								 | 
							
								    }
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								    return false;
							 | 
						||
| 
								 | 
							
								  }
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								  remove(element) {
							 | 
						||
| 
								 | 
							
								    if (this.has(element)) {
							 | 
						||
| 
								 | 
							
								      delete this.dictionary[element];
							 | 
						||
| 
								 | 
							
								      this.length--;
							 | 
						||
| 
								 | 
							
								      return true;
							 | 
						||
| 
								 | 
							
								    }
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								    return false;
							 | 
						||
| 
								 | 
							
								  }
							 | 
						||
| 
								 | 
							
								
							 | 
						||
| 
								 | 
							
								  size() {
							 | 
						||
| 
								 | 
							
								    return this.length;
							 | 
						||
| 
								 | 
							
								  }
							 | 
						||
| 
								 | 
							
								}
							 | 
						||
| 
								 | 
							
								```
